Who is Edgar Davids?
Edgar Davids is one of the most recognizable figures in world football, not only because of his powerful midfield performances but also due to his unique look and unmistakable presence. Born in Suriname and raised in the Netherlands, Davids’ football journey took him through some of Europe’s most prestigious clubs including Ajax, AC Milan, Juventus, Inter Milan, Tottenham, and of course, FC Barcelona. Known for his tenacity, energy, and fierce tackling, he was affectionately nicknamed “The Pitbull” — a moniker that perfectly captured his aggressive yet highly skilled style of play. Davids was a box-to-box midfielder who combined grit with grace, tactical intelligence with raw athleticism.
His iconic orange-tinted goggles, worn due to glaucoma, only added to his legendary status, making him instantly identifiable on the pitch. When he joined Barcelona on loan in January 2004, the club was struggling both tactically and emotionally, but his arrival would soon alter the trajectory of their season and the club’s modern history.
Historical Context: Davids’ Time at Barcelona
In the 2003–04 season, FC Barcelona was facing one of its most difficult transitions in modern history. Under the new management of Frank Rijkaard, the team was underperforming and found itself mid-table in La Liga. Lacking midfield balance and struggling with consistency, Barcelona needed an injection of grit and leadership. Edgar Davids arrived in January 2004 on loan from Juventus as a stopgap solution, but his effect was immediate and transformational. He brought intensity, work rate, and much-needed control to the midfield, which in turn allowed creative players like Ronaldinho and Xavi to thrive. His ability to break up attacks and transition quickly into offense gave the team new life. During the remainder of the season, Barcelona went on a remarkable run, finishing second in La Liga after being 12th when Davids arrived.
Although he left at the end of the season, many fans and analysts believe that his presence helped lay the foundation for the golden era that followed, leading to dominance under Rijkaard and later, Pep Guardiola. Design Features of the 2003–04 Edgar Davids Nameset Barcelona
The 2003–04 FC Barcelona jersey worn by Edgar Davids features design elements that make it stand out from many other versions. The shirt showcases the club’s traditional blue and garnet vertical stripes — bold and unmistakably Barça. The Nike swoosh is placed prominently, as Nike was the kit manufacturer at the time, and the design reflects early 2000s aesthetics with a modern fit for that era. The edgar davids nameset barcelona features the classic La Liga font style used that season, which includes bold, blocky letters and large, high-contrast white numbers — Davids wore number 3.
The nameset is heat-pressed, not stitched, which is a detail collectors use to distinguish authentic versions. The fabric used in match-worn versions includes higher-grade materials with moisture-wicking technology and finer stitching details. Inner collar tags or label imprints also carry season-specific details that help verify authenticity. How to Spot an Authentic Edgar Davids Nameset Barcelona
With the rise of football memorabilia collecting, counterfeit jerseys have become more common, making it critical for buyers to know how to verify the authenticity of a true edgar davids nameset barcelona. One of the first things to look for is the correct La Liga font that was used during the 2003–04 season. Authentic shirts feature heat-pressed names and numbers with crisp, clean edges. The number should be 3 — the number Davids wore during his short tenure at the club. Also, check the La Liga patch on the sleeve — it should have accurate stitching and not look cheaply printed or glued.
Look inside the collar for official Nike tags with production codes that match the season. Match-worn jerseys may feature breathable mesh zones and lighter fabric compared to retail versions. Avoid shirts with inconsistent fonts, wrong numbers, or poor-quality heat transfers. Purchasing from a trusted source is crucial to ensuring the authenticity of your edgar davids nameset barcelona.

How Much Does an Edgar Davids Barcelona Nameset Cost? Price Guide for Collectors
The price of a genuine edgar davids nameset barcelona jersey can vary dramatically depending on its condition, provenance, and whether it’s match-worn. A brand new, unworn shirt with original tags can fetch between $200 and $500. If the jersey is match-worn or player-issued, expect the value to soar to $500 to $1,500 or more, especially if supported by documentation. Used or second-hand versions in good condition typically sell for $100 to $300. Replicas — not officially issued but still styled correctly — may be found for $50 to $150, but their value is primarily aesthetic rather than collectible.
Features that increase value include original tags, signed versions, La Liga patches, or rare event patches (like El Clásico). Jerseys with documented provenance, such as match use or photo evidence, are significantly more valuable. Care and Storage Tips to Preserve Your Edgar Davids Jersey
Whether you own an original or a custom-made edgar davids nameset barcelona jersey, proper care is essential to maintaining its quality and value. Always hand-wash the jersey with a mild detergent in cold water, and never use bleach or harsh chemicals. Machine washing may damage the heat-pressed nameset, causing it to peel or crack. Air dry the jersey on a hanger in a shaded area — avoid tumble drying or direct sunlight, which can fade colors.
For long-term storage, hang the jersey on a padded hanger or store it in a breathable garment bag in a cool, dark environment. If you wish to display it, use a UV-protected frame to prevent fading over time.
